<P><FONT SIZE=2 FACE="Arial">I'm trying to reduce the cell count of a vtkUnstructuredGrid and I'm hoping there is a way to do this using existing vtk filters. I have a tetrahedral volume where many of the cells have a common scalar value. I would like to create a larger tetrahedra by combining existing tets that share a face and have a common scalar value. In other words can I take 2 adjacent tet cells that have the same temperature value and combine them creating a new tet? For my purposes the final output would need to be a single vtkUnstructuredGrid dataset.</FONT></P>
<P><FONT SIZE=2 FACE="Arial">I've seen some of the threads that talk about using a vtkGeometryFilter and then vtkDecimatePro however I'm not sure it applies since I need the final result to be a unstructured grid of tets? </FONT></P>
